Sos steel, ceramics, glass, paper: all on hold due to high energy prices

The situation of entire production sectors due to high energy is increasingly critical - Monday summit in Torbole to study solutions

Sos steel, ceramics, glass, paper: all on hold due to high energy prices

It can't go on like this. The high-energy price is bringing to its knees many productive activities. In Italy there are countless steel mills, foundries, glass factories, paper mills, cement factories and aluminum factories forced to close because the high energy and high gas prices are strangling them. And the coming month of January will be the month of truth: either things change and costs become manageable again or the closures risk having no return or at least long-term, to the benefit of foreign but also national competition which can gain shares of market.

To deal with the emergency and find solutions, on Monday 27 December there will be a summit in Torbole, on Lake Garda, of Assofond, Confindustria Ceramica, Assocarta and Assovetro. Federacciai is also on the alert.

And to think that the market is buoyant and that there is no shortage of orders but for the companies in question the costs have become unsustainable: either they produce at a loss waiting for better times or they close.
